CN105471909A - 一种快速建立局域网连接的方法及发起设备、路由设备 - Google Patents

一种快速建立局域网连接的方法及发起设备、路由设备 Download PDF

Info

Publication number
CN105471909A
CN105471909A CN201511030406.5A CN201511030406A CN105471909A CN 105471909 A CN105471909 A CN 105471909A CN 201511030406 A CN201511030406 A CN 201511030406A CN 105471909 A CN105471909 A CN 105471909A
Authority
CN
China
Prior art keywords
module
target device
devices
list
initiating equipment
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CN201511030406.5A
Other languages
English (en)
Other versions
CN105471909B (zh
Inventor
崔宗科
韩柏虎
***
付文杰
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Shandong Taixin Electronics Co Ltd
Original Assignee
Shandong Taixin Electronics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Shandong Taixin Electronics Co Ltd filed Critical Shandong Taixin Electronics Co Ltd
Priority to CN201511030406.5A priority Critical patent/CN105471909B/zh
Publication of CN105471909A publication Critical patent/CN105471909A/zh
Application granted granted Critical
Publication of CN105471909B publication Critical patent/CN105471909B/zh
Active legal-status Critical Current
Anticipated expiration legal-status Critical

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L65/00Network arrangements, protocols or services for supporting real-time applications in data packet communication
    • H04L65/1066Session management
    • H04L65/1069Session establishment or de-establishment

Landscapes

  • Engineering & Computer Science (AREA)
  • Business, Economics & Management (AREA)
  • General Business, Economics & Management (AREA)
  • Multimedia (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)
  • Small-Scale Networks (AREA)

Abstract

本发明公开了一种快速建立局域网连接的方法及发起设备、路由设备,快速建立局域网连接的方法,步骤为:S101:发起设备从路由设备获取在线设备列表;S102:发起设备查找在线设备列表中是否存在目标设备的特征信息,若存在,执行步骤S103;S103:发起设备根据目标设备的特征信息获取目标设备的IP地址和MAC地址;S104:发起设备根据目标设备的IP地址和MAC地址向目标设备发送连接请求;S105:发起设备与目标设备建立网络连接。它使得同一局域网内的设备之间可以快速、稳定的建立连接,实现简单,有利于提升产品的用户体验。

Description

一种快速建立局域网连接的方法及发起设备、路由设备
技术领域
本发明涉及一种快速建立局域网连接的方法及发起设备、路由设备。
背景技术
同一个局域网的两个设备需要进行通信时,由于未建立连接之前不知道对方的IP地址和MAC地址,一般通过如下步骤建立连接:
首先,发起设备向局域网内的所有设备发送广播消息;
其次,目标设备收到广播消息后,确认是否需要回复该广播消息;
再次,目标设备发送回复消息给发起设备,回复消息包含目标设备的IP地址和MAC地址;
再次,发起设备从回复消息中获取目标设备的IP地址和MAC地址;
最后,发起设备与目标设备建立连接并进行通信。
这种连接方式需要向局域网内所有设备发送广播消息,步骤稍多,不够简便,并且有时广播消息发送不可靠,不一定能成功的发出广播消息或者收到回复消息,导致无法正常建立连接进行通信。
发明内容
本发明的目的就是为了解决上述问题,提供了一种快速建立局域网连接的方法及发起设备、路由设备,它可以使得同一局域网内的设备之间快速建立连接,实现简单,有利于提升产品的用户体验。
为了实现上述目的,本发明采用如下技术方案:
一种快速建立局域网连接的方法,步骤为:
S101:发起设备从路由设备获取在线设备列表;
S102:发起设备查找在线设备列表中是否存在目标设备的特征信息,若存在,执行步骤S103;
S103:发起设备根据目标设备的特征信息获取目标设备的IP地址和MAC地址;
S104:发起设备根据目标设备的IP地址和MAC地址向目标设备发送连接请求;
S105:发起设备与目标设备建立网络连接。
所述步骤S101之前还包括:发起设备连接路由设备,并发送身份信息给路由设备。
所述步骤S102进一步包括:若在线设备列表不存在目标设备的特征信息,则发起设备向局域网发送广播消息,在接收到目标设备发送的回复消息后与目标设备建立连接,并保存目标设备的特征信息。
所述在线设备列表至少包括与路由设备连接的目标设备的特征信息、IP地址、MAC地址中的一种。
所述特征信息至少包括设备名称、设备号码、MAC地址中的一种。
一种快速建立局域网连接的方法,步骤为:
S201:路由设备与目标设备/发起设备建立连接,更新在线设备列表;
S202:路由设备接收来自发起设备的下载在线设备列表的请求;
S203:路由设备发送在线设备列表给发起设备。
所述步骤S203进一步包括:路由设备对发起设备的身份信息进行验证,若验证通过,则发送在线设备列表给发起设备;否则,不发送在线设备列表给发起设备。
所述步骤S201还包括:路由设备与目标设备/发起设备断开连接时,更新在线设备列表。
一种发起设备,包括:
第一控制模块,分别与第一数据收发模块、列表获取模块、比较模块和第一存储模块双向通信,负责对各模块进行配置,并控制各模块协同工作;
第一数据收发模块,分别与列表获取模块、第一存储模块双向通信,负责与目标设备或者路由设备建立网路连接,并进行数据通信;
列表获取模块,负责从路由设备获取在线设备列表;
比较模块,分别与列表获取模块和第一存储模块双向通信,负责解析在线设备列表,判断在线设备列表中是否存在目标设备的特征信息,并根据特征信息获取目标设备的IP地址与MAC地址;
第一存储模块,负责存储配置信息及目标设备的特征信息。
一种路由设备,包括:
第二控制模块,分别与数据收发模块、身份验证模块、列表更新模块和第二存储模块双向通信,负责对各模块进行配置,并控制各模块协同工作;
第二数据收发模块,分别与验证模块、列表更新模块和第二存储模块双向通信,负责路由设备与外部设备之间的数据通信;
身份验证模块,负责对与路由设备连接的外部设备的身份信息进行验证;
列表更新模块,与第二存储模块双向通信,在外部设备与路由设备的连接状态发生变化时,负责更新在线设备列表信息;
第二存储模块,负责存储配置信息及在线设备列表信息。
本发明的有益效果:通过路由设备中的在线设备列表,在发起设备与目标设备建立连接时,发起设备避免了每次通过广播消息查询目标设备IP地址和/或MAC地址的过程,可以在局域网环境下快速建立发起设备与目标设备之间的连接通道,简化了连接建立过程,避免了通常的发送和回复广播的繁琐情况,同时也避免了在无线情况下广播消息收发不可靠的情况,提升了用户体验。
附图说明
图1为本发明所述方法实施例1流程图;
图2为本发明所述方法实施例2流程图;
图3为本发明所述发起设备结构示意图;
图4为本发明所述路由设备结构示意图。
具体实施方式
下面结合附图与实施例对本发明作进一步说明。
实施例1:
如图1所示,一种快速建立局域网连接的方法,步骤为:
S101:发起设备从路由设备获取在线设备列表;
S102:发起设备查找在线设备列表中是否存在目标设备的特征信息,若存在,执行步骤S103;
S103:发起设备根据目标设备的特征信息获取目标设备的IP地址和MAC地址;
S104:发起设备根据目标设备的IP地址和MAC地址向目标设备发送连接请求;
S105:发起设备与目标设备建立网络连接。
所述步骤S101之前还包括:发起设备连接路由设备,并发送身份信息给路由设备。
所述身份信息可以为路由设备提前分配给发起设备的用户名和密码。
所述步骤S102进一步包括:若在线设备列表不存在目标设备的特征信息,则发起设备向局域网发送广播消息,在接收到目标设备发送的回复消息后与目标设备建立连接,并保存目标设备的特征信息。
所述在线设备列表至少包括与路由设备连接的目标设备的特征信息、IP地址、MAC地址中的一种。
所述特征信息至少包括设备名称、设备号码、MAC地址中的一种。
实施例2:
如图2所示,一种快速建立局域网连接的方法,步骤为:
S201:路由设备与目标设备/发起设备建立连接,更新在线设备列表;
S202:路由设备接收来自发起设备的下载在线设备列表的请求;
S203:路由设备发送在线设备列表给发起设备。
所述步骤S203进一步包括:路由设备对发起设备的身份信息进行验证,若验证通过,则发送在线设备列表给发起设备;否则,不发送在线设备列表给发起设备。
所述步骤S201还包括:路由设备与目标设备/发起设备断开连接时,更新在线设备列表。
如图3所示,发起设备,包括:
第一控制模块,分别与第一数据收发模块、列表获取模块、比较模块和第一存储模块双向通信,负责对各模块进行配置,并控制各模块协同工作;
第一数据收发模块,分别与列表获取模块、第一存储模块双向通信,负责与目标设备或者路由设备建立网路连接,并进行数据通信;
列表获取模块,负责从路由设备获取在线设备列表;
比较模块,分别与列表获取模块和第一存储模块双向通信,负责解析在线设备列表,判断在线设备列表中是否存在目标设备的特征信息,并根据特征信息获取目标设备的IP地址与MAC地址;
第一存储模块,负责存储配置信息及目标设备的特征信息。
如图4所示,路由设备,包括:
第二控制模块,分别与数据收发模块、身份验证模块、列表更新模块和第二存储模块双向通信,负责对各模块进行配置,并控制各模块协同工作;
第二数据收发模块,分别与验证模块、列表更新模块和第二存储模块双向通信,负责路由设备与外部设备之间的数据通信;
身份验证模块,负责对与路由设备连接的外部设备的身份信息进行验证;
列表更新模块,与第二存储模块双向通信,在外部设备与路由设备的连接状态发生变化时,负责更新在线设备列表信息;
第二存储模块,负责存储配置信息及在线设备列表信息。
上述虽然结合附图对本发明的具体实施方式进行了描述,但并非对本发明保护范围的限制,所属领域技术人员应该明白,在本发明的技术方案的基础上,本领域技术人员不需要付出创造性劳动即可做出的各种修改或变形仍在本发明的保护范围以内。

Claims (10)

1.一种快速建立局域网连接的方法,其特征是,步骤为:
S101:发起设备从路由设备获取在线设备列表;
S102:发起设备查找在线设备列表中是否存在目标设备的特征信息,若存在,执行步骤S103;
S103:发起设备根据目标设备的特征信息获取目标设备的IP地址和MAC地址;
S104:发起设备根据目标设备的IP地址和MAC地址向目标设备发送连接请求;
S105:发起设备与目标设备建立网络连接。
2.如权利要求1所述的快速建立局域网连接的方法,其特征是,所述步骤S101之前还包括:发起设备连接路由设备,并发送身份信息给路由设备。
3.如权利要求1所述的快速建立局域网连接的方法,其特征是,所述步骤S102进一步包括:若在线设备列表不存在目标设备的特征信息,则发起设备向局域网发送广播消息,在接收到目标设备发送的回复消息后与目标设备建立连接,并保存目标设备的特征信息。
4.如权利要求1所述的快速建立局域网连接的方法,其特征是,所述在线设备列表至少包括与路由设备连接的目标设备的特征信息、IP地址、MAC地址中的一种。
5.如权利要求1所述的快速建立局域网连接的方法,其特征是,所述特征信息至少包括设备名称、设备号码、MAC地址中的一种。
6.一种快速建立局域网连接的方法,其特征是,步骤为:
S201:路由设备与目标设备/发起设备建立连接,更新在线设备列表;
S202:路由设备接收来自发起设备的下载在线设备列表的请求;
S203:路由设备发送在线设备列表给发起设备。
7.如权利要求6所述的快速建立局域网连接的方法,其特征是,所述步骤S203进一步包括:路由设备对发起设备的身份信息进行验证,若验证通过,则发送在线设备列表给发起设备;否则,不发送在线设备列表给发起设备。
8.如权利要求6所述的快速建立局域网连接的方法,其特征是,所述步骤S201还包括:路由设备与目标设备/发起设备断开连接时,更新在线设备列表。
9.一种发起设备,其特征是,包括:
第一控制模块,分别与第一数据收发模块、列表获取模块、比较模块和第一存储模块双向通信,负责对各模块进行配置,并控制各模块协同工作;
第一数据收发模块,分别与列表获取模块、第一存储模块双向通信,负责与目标设备或者路由设备建立网路连接,并进行数据通信;
列表获取模块,负责从路由设备获取在线设备列表;
比较模块,分别与列表获取模块和第一存储模块通信,负责解析在线设备列表,判断在线设备列表中是否存在目标设备的特征信息,并根据特征信息获取目标设备的IP地址与MAC地址;
第一存储模块,负责存储配置信息及目标设备的特征信息。
10.一种路由设备,其特征是,包括:
第二控制模块,分别与数据收发模块、身份验证模块、列表更新模块和第二存储模块双向通信,负责对各模块进行配置,并控制各模块协同工作;
第二数据收发模块,分别与验证模块、列表更新模块和第二存储模块双向通信,负责路由设备与外部设备之间的数据通信;
身份验证模块,负责对与路由设备连接的外部设备的身份信息进行验证;
列表更新模块,与第二存储模块双向通信,在外部设备与路由设备的连接状态发生变化时,负责更新在线设备列表信息;
第二存储模块,负责存储配置信息及在线设备列表信息。
CN201511030406.5A 2015-12-31 2015-12-31 一种快速建立局域网连接的方法及发起设备、路由设备 Active CN105471909B (zh)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201511030406.5A CN105471909B (zh) 2015-12-31 2015-12-31 一种快速建立局域网连接的方法及发起设备、路由设备

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201511030406.5A CN105471909B (zh) 2015-12-31 2015-12-31 一种快速建立局域网连接的方法及发起设备、路由设备

Publications (2)

Publication Number Publication Date
CN105471909A true CN105471909A (zh) 2016-04-06
CN105471909B CN105471909B (zh) 2019-04-12

Family

ID=55609179

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201511030406.5A Active CN105471909B (zh) 2015-12-31 2015-12-31 一种快速建立局域网连接的方法及发起设备、路由设备

Country Status (1)

Country Link
CN (1) CN105471909B (zh)

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N105898233A (zh) * 2016-05-27 2016-08-24 浙江宇视科技有限公司 一种视频监控中的音视频播放方法及装置
CN106708589A (zh) * 2017-01-17 2017-05-24 浙江众合科技股份有限公司 轨道交通信号设备的升级方法
CN115442414A (zh) * 2022-08-25 2022-12-06 深圳康佳电子科技有限公司 一种设备连接方法、装置、智能终端及存储介质

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N102752748A (zh) * 2012-06-26 2012-10-24 中国联合网络通信集团有限公司 基于移动终端的数据传输方法和***以及移动终端
CN103220312A (zh) * 2012-01-20 2013-07-24 物联智慧股份有限公司 建立点对点连线的***及其方法
CN104506397A (zh) * 2014-12-09 2015-04-08 深圳市共进电子股份有限公司 智能设备接入局域网的方法及***

Patent Citations (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N103220312A (zh) * 2012-01-20 2013-07-24 物联智慧股份有限公司 建立点对点连线的***及其方法
CN102752748A (zh) * 2012-06-26 2012-10-24 中国联合网络通信集团有限公司 基于移动终端的数据传输方法和***以及移动终端
CN104506397A (zh) * 2014-12-09 2015-04-08 深圳市共进电子股份有限公司 智能设备接入局域网的方法及***

Cited By (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N105898233A (zh) * 2016-05-27 2016-08-24 浙江宇视科技有限公司 一种视频监控中的音视频播放方法及装置
CN105898233B (zh) * 2016-05-27 2019-03-08 浙江宇视科技有限公司 一种视频监控中的音视频播放方法及装置
CN106708589A (zh) * 2017-01-17 2017-05-24 浙江众合科技股份有限公司 轨道交通信号设备的升级方法
CN115442414A (zh) * 2022-08-25 2022-12-06 深圳康佳电子科技有限公司 一种设备连接方法、装置、智能终端及存储介质

Also Published As

Publication number Publication date
CN105471909B (zh) 2019-04-12

Similar Documents

Publication Publication Date Title
WO2020038256A1 (en) Data transmission method and apparatus
CN110324246B (zh) 一种通信方法及装置
CN110366153B (zh) 一种蓝牙自组网的方法
CN105392181B (zh) 一种智能设备的联网方法、装置及***
CN106656547B (zh) 一种更新家电设备网络配置的方法和装置
US20150249946A1 (en) Network connection method and device supporting same
CN108011754B (zh) 转控分离***、备份方法和装置
CN102752413B (zh) Dhcp服务器选择方法和网络设备
CN103702312A (zh) 无线信息传输方法和设备
CN103312708B (zh) 一种基于租约文件的ip设定方法及***
CN104144463A (zh) Wi-Fi网络接入方法和***
EP3307012A1 (en) Method and device for communications
CN105450779A (zh) 一家电设备连接多服务器的方法
US9356908B2 (en) Method and system for causing a client device to renew a dynamic IP address
CN103491005A (zh) 一种报文转发控制方法、接入点设备和相关***
CN104936258A (zh) 网络连接方法、终端及***
CN104202364A (zh) 一种控制器的自动发现和配置方法和设备
CN105471909A (zh) 一种快速建立局域网连接的方法及发起设备、路由设备
CN102710629B (zh) 网络连接方法和***
CN112019408A (zh) 用于在家庭网络中安装节点的方法和设备
CN104869621A (zh) 一种网络识别方法和装置
CN105246129B (zh) 一种智能终端的组网方法及装置
US20140204797A1 (en) Wireless access point device, network system and network auto-establishing method of the same
WO2008093164A3 (en) Communication system and method
CN107257558B (zh) 报文转发方法及装置

Legal Events

Date Code Title Description
C06 Publication
PB01 Publication
C10 Entry into substantive examination
SE01 Entry into force of request for substantive examination
GR01 Patent grant
GR01 Patent grant
PE01 Entry into force of the registration of the contract for pledge of patent right
PE01 Entry into force of the registration of the contract for pledge of patent right

Denomination of invention: A method of quickly establishing LAN connection and its initiating device and routing device

Effective date of registration: 20220622

Granted publication date: 20190412

Pledgee: Qilu bank Limited by Share Ltd. Ji'nan Zhang Zhuang sub branch

Pledgor: SHANDONG TAIXIN ELECTRONICS Co.,Ltd.

Registration number: Y2022980008497